AMD Ryzen 7 7700X vs AMD Ryzen 7 3700X

We compared two desktop CPUs: AMD Ryzen 7 7700X with 8 cores 4.5GHz and AMD Ryzen 7 3700X with 8 cores 3.6G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 7 7700X 's Advantages
Released 3 years and 2 months late
Integrated graphics card
Higher specification of memory (DDR5-5200 vs DDR4-3200)
Larger memory bandwidth (83.2GB/s vs 47.68GB/s)
Newer PCIe version (5.0 vs 4.0)
Higher base frequency (4.5GHz vs 3.6GHz)
More modern manufacturing process (5nm vs 7nm)
AMD Ryzen 7 3700X 's Advantages
Lower TDP (65W vs 105W)
